As a young child I became aware of evil in the world from a very young age, through observation of the way people could be nasty and cruel to others. Parallel to this I observed in my own life that I always seemed to be protected from the bad things that happened. Something always intervened before it was too late.
One day I went swimming with neighbourhood kids, in a hole in the local Whanganui River. The river was very swift and turbulent. The challenge was to dive in facing upstream and swim as fast as we could to get across the hole and land down stream on a shallow ridge of shingle. This time when I did it, I ended up being pushed up under a ledge! I felt panic, then a calm peaceful voice; gentle but firm, instruct me to just relax and the water would take me out. I obeyed and saw the beautiful rays of sunlight dancing off the stones on the bottom of the river. Eventually I drifted to the surface near the edge and I struggled out. I knew I had been saved, as the older children told me they had been looking for me for ages and were convinced I had drowned.
I instinctively knew that voice was the voice of someone greater than life watching over me, God my protector!
